Abstract
PURPOSE: To make possible die cooling and improve the durability of dies without decreasing production amount by disposing a plurality of the same dies for every process to the presses of the automated hot transfer forging line and using these alternately.
CONSTITUTION: Two pieces a set of the same dies of plural processes, i.e., the dies A3, B3 of the 1st process, the dies A4, B4 of the 2nd process and the dies A5, B5 of the 3rd process in this order are continuously arrayed between the bolster 1a and slide 1b of the automated forging press 1. The work 2 having been heated in a heating furnace goes through idle process A2 and is carried to the one die A3 side of the 1st process, thence it goes through the dies A4, A5 to complete forging. The next work 2 being carried in continuously is carried into the 1st process die B3 through the idle process B2 and goes through the dies B4, B5 to complete forging. Since the two pieces a set of the dies of the same process are alternately used, the cooling of the dies may be executed and durability improved.
